◎ 【New Faculty Interview】Professor Konstantin Weicht

Professor Konstantin Weicht, who joined NSYSU in August 2018, is from the City of Music, Vienna, in Austria. Professor Weicht has both academic and professional credentials. As an Electrical Engineer by profession, he pursued his academic studies in England, with a Master of Research from the School of Construction & Property Management at the University of Salford and a PhD in Organization and Management from Sheffield Hallam University, UK. This is coupled with professional experience in the service industry and health care sector, both in Austria and the UK.

A personal decision to move to Taiwan in 2014 (Taiwanese wife, two children) has broadened his perspectives further, whether this be through living in and learning about a new culture, conducting cross-cultural research, gaining first experiences in academia in Taiwan, or starting and running his own business (a wood fire stone-oven bakery and pizza place that ranked #1 on tripadvisor).

A proponent of the Humboldtian education ideal, Professor Weicht believes that his role in the education system is to facilitate the development of “autonomous individuals” and “citizens of the world” (Weltbuerger). Students at NSYSU should leave with more than a degree – they should be “good people” who can then become “good businessmen and women or managers”.

Professor Weicht currently teaches Organization Theory & Management, Organizational Behavior, and Research Methodology. Apart from his teaching, he hopes to advance his academic career as an international management scholar. Besides his work commitment, he enjoys the outdoors, sports, classical music, and spending time with his family.
